Fifth Grade Science Online Tools Training
With the Science test for 5th Grade going online, there will be tools that students will need to use that they may not currently be familiar with. This link will take you to a login screen, where a login and password is provided to you on the screen. The first few slides include directions and explanations for the various tools and icons that students will encounter on the test. Then there are practice questions where students will see the types of questions they might have on the test and have the opportunity to use the tools they will see on the assessment. This is a great opportunity to walk students through these things. For access, go to:
https://wbte.drcedirect.com/MO/portals/mo
This needs to be on a Chrome browser to work and is only until the INSIGHT desktop/device icons are installed on all computers that will be used for testing. The tests for grade 5 and 8 are almost identical, but they will give your students (and the teacher) some background on what the test format will look like. There are tools that are used in the training, such as the need to graph and measure with a ruler, plus there is a drag and drop and fill in the blank questions.
